Grilled Corn on the Cob: A Summery Twist to Burger Meals

Grilled corn on the cob is a summery twist that adds a burst of flavor to your burger meals. The smoky char from the grill enhances the natural sweetness of the corn, creating a mouthwatering combination. Simply brush the corn with melted butter, sprinkle with salt and pepper, and grill until tender and slightly charred. The juicy kernels provide a satisfying crunch that complements the juicy burger patty. It's a perfect side dish to enjoy during outdoor barbecues or picnics, adding a touch of summer to your burger experience.

Tangy Coleslaw: Balancing the Richness of Burgers

Tangy coleslaw is the perfect side dish to balance out the richness of burgers. With its crisp and refreshing texture, it provides a delightful contrast to the juicy and savory flavors of the burger. The tanginess of the dressing, usually made with mayonnaise, vinegar, and a touch of sugar, adds a zing that cuts through the heaviness of the meat. The combination of crunchy cabbage, carrots, and onions also adds a satisfying crunch to each bite. Whether served on top of the burger or enjoyed on its own, tangy coleslaw is a must-have side dish for any burger lover.

Baked Beans: A Hearty and Flavorful Side Dish for Burgers

Baked beans are a classic and hearty side dish that pairs perfectly with burgers. The rich and flavorful combination of tender beans, smoky bacon, and tangy tomato sauce adds depth to your burger experience. The sweetness from brown sugar and molasses enhances the overall taste, creating a mouthwatering accompaniment. Whether you prefer them homemade or canned, baked beans bring a comforting and satisfying element to your burger meal. So next time you fire up the grill, don't forget to serve up some delicious baked beans alongside your juicy burger.
